From 2bdf4c590aa28ee6b27bf2a43e73112475312b32 Mon Sep 17 00:00:00 2001 From: Michal Simek Date: Tue, 22 Jun 2010 15:25:24 +0200 Subject: [PATCH] --- yaml --- r: 204657 b: refs/heads/master c: 06b2864038517905752bdacd95f1f265ef780f3b h: refs/heads/master i: 204655: 377bcefb2e5430b21b1bec23c100d04e648630c6 v: v3 --- [refs] | 2 +- trunk/arch/microblaze/kernel/entry.S | 7 ++----- 2 files changed, 3 insertions(+), 6 deletions(-) diff --git a/[refs] b/[refs] index dc887f26fd77..2ac7626bb662 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 8b110d157c82f3818fc578b633f0cf7ace9efc22 +refs/heads/master: 06b2864038517905752bdacd95f1f265ef780f3b diff --git a/trunk/arch/microblaze/kernel/entry.S b/trunk/arch/microblaze/kernel/entry.S index 042657165184..04267ca949f0 100644 --- a/trunk/arch/microblaze/kernel/entry.S +++ b/trunk/arch/microblaze/kernel/entry.S @@ -895,15 +895,12 @@ C_ENTRY(_debug_exception): swi r0, r1, PTO+PT_R0; tovirt(r1,r1) + set_vms; addi r5, r0, SIGTRAP /* send the trap signal */ add r6, r0, CURRENT_TASK; /* Get current task ptr into r11 */ addk r7, r0, r0 /* 3rd param zero */ - - set_vms; - addik r11, r0, send_sig; +dbtrap_call: rtbd r0, send_sig; addik r15, r0, dbtrap_call; -dbtrap_call: rtbd r11, 0; - nop; set_bip; /* Ints masked for state restore*/ lwi r11, r1, PTO+PT_MODE;